You can create dunning letters to remind customers about the status of past-due invoices, improving the collections process. Example: Sending your customer a dunning letter that includes all overdue invoices.
You can:
  • Select from 3 dunning letter templates of increasing severity, or create your own dunning letters from these templates.
  • Include invoice adjustments, invoices with negative amount, invoices in dispute, or on hold when you print the dunning letters.
  • Include latest interest and late fee calculations for past-due invoices in the dunning PDF when you haven't yet generated finance charges.
  • Configure specific customer profiles to exclude them from receiving dunning letters.
  • Email letters to customers that have
    Email
    configured as a preferred delivery method.
  • Print letters for customers who prefer to receive them by mail.
Workday doesn't:
  • Include consolidated invoices in dunning letters.
  • Generate a dunning letter PDF for multiple currencies in a single print run.
  1. (Optional) To enable emailing of dunning letters, select the
    Email
    channel on your routing rule for custom business process notifications.
    When you edit
    Custom Notifications
    on the
    Dunning Letter Email Event
    business process, ensure that the
    Repeat On
    prompt is set to
    Dunning Letters to be Emailed
    . If you leave this field blank, Workday sends all the dunning letters to everyone.
  2. Access the
    Print Dunning Letters
    task.
  3. As you complete the task, consider:
    Option Description
    Dunning Level Group
    Access the
    Create Dunning Level Group
    task from this prompt to configure dunning levels.
    Customers to Exclude
    You can specify 1 or more customers to exclude from this print run.
    Generate Associated Invoice PDFs
    When invoices use different business form layouts, Workday generates 1 file for each business form layout.
    To include associated invoices when you email dunning letters, configure the Dunning Letter Email Event business process.
    Group Dunning Letters for Mailing
    In addition to creating individual dunning letters, Workday groups letters by dunning level and customer locale for customers with:
    • Mail
      configured as a delivery method.
    • No configured delivery method.
    Override Dunning Level Setting
    To override the dunning level selection, you can include:
    • All Open Invoices
    • All Overdue Invoices
    Workday will ignore the aging days you specified in the
    Dunning Levels
    option, but will continue to use the
    Business Form Layout
    associated with the selected dunning level.
